Former WDAY/Fargo Morning Man Don Dresser Dies

Condolences to family and friends of former WDAY-A/FARGO, ND morning host DON DRESSER, who died FRIDAY (8/18) at 94, according to the station.
DRESSER, who started at KTRF-A/THIEF RIVER FALLS, MN, joined WDAY in 1960, moved into mornings in 1962, paired for several years with EARL WILLIAMS, and retired in 1994. He was inducted into the MINNESOTA BROADCASTING HALL OF FAME in 2002 and last appeared on WDAY during CHRISTOPHER GABRIEL's show as part of the station's 90th birthday celebration in 2012.
